Being addicted to others’ opinions of us is extremely destructive. An excessive need for people to approve and validate us can cause guilt, shame, and insecurity in us. This kind of addiction leads us to seek others’ approval before we can value ourselves, and causes us to greatly fear rejection and disapproval from people who do not even care about us. It can lead to anxiety, depression, and mental health issues. Craving others’ acceptance and forgetting that God has already accepted us is tragic; realizing that He approves of us helps us break this addiction. Our mental outlook and self-respect immediately begin to improve when we decide that we like ourselves, regardless of what others think. We will not need the world’s validation when we know that we are already God’s beloved, and the apple of His eye.
